Tarapur Transformers Limited (TARAPUR) - Total Assets
Based on the latest financial reports, Tarapur Transformers Limited (TARAPUR) holds total assets worth Rs113.54 Million INR (≈ $1.23 Million USD) as of September 2025. Total assets represent everything the company owns and controls, combining both current assets—like cash and cash equivalents, accounts receivable, and inventories—and non-current assets such as property, plant, equipment (PP&E), intangible assets, and long-term investments. Key Asset Composition Facts
- Current vs. Non-Current Assets: Tarapur Transformers Limited's current assets represent 49.0% of total assets in 2025, a decrease from 56.6% in 2007.
- Cash Position: Cash and equivalents constituted 1.2% of total assets in 2025, down from 19.6% in 2007.
- Tangible vs. Intangible: Intangible assets (including goodwill) make up 0.0% of total assets, unchanged from 0.0% in 2007.
- Asset Diversification: The largest asset category is property, plant & equipment at 34.6% of total assets.

Annual Total Assets for Tarapur Transformers Limited (2007–2025)
The table below shows the annual total assets of Tarapur Transformers Limited from 2007 to 2025.
| Year | Total Assets |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2025-03-31 | Rs119.55 Million ≈ $1.29 Million |
-45.19% |
| 2024-03-31 | Rs218.11 Million ≈ $2.36 Million |
-3.15% |
| 2023-03-31 | Rs225.21 Million ≈ $2.44 Million |
-62.14% |
| 2022-03-31 | Rs594.78 Million ≈ $6.43 Million |
+14.37% |
| 2021-03-31 | Rs520.07 Million ≈ $5.62 Million |
-27.36% |
| 2020-03-31 | Rs715.94 Million ≈ $7.74 Million |
-10.55% |
| 2019-03-31 | Rs800.34 Million ≈ $8.66 Million |
-2.81% |
| 2018-03-31 | Rs823.47 Million ≈ $8.91 Million |
-23.91% |
| 2017-03-31 | Rs1.08 Billion ≈ $11.70 Million |
-1.83% |
| 2016-03-31 | Rs1.10 Billion ≈ $11.92 Million |
+7.25% |
| 2015-03-31 | Rs1.03 Billion ≈ $11.12 Million |
-0.77% |
| 2014-03-31 | Rs1.04 Billion ≈ $11.20 Million |
-5.55% |
| 2013-03-31 | Rs1.10 Billion ≈ $11.86 Million |
+4.43% |
| 2012-03-31 | Rs1.05 Billion ≈ $11.36 Million |
+7.51% |
| 2011-03-31 | Rs976.77 Million ≈ $10.56 Million |
+72.00% |
| 2010-03-31 | Rs567.88 Million ≈ $6.14 Million |
+40.93% |
| 2009-03-31 | Rs402.95 Million ≈ $4.36 Million |
+50.41% |
| 2008-03-31 | Rs267.90 Million ≈ $2.90 Million |
+158.60% |
| 2007-03-31 | Rs103.60 Million ≈ $1.12 Million |
-- |
About Tarapur Transformers Limited
Tarapur Transformers Limited engages in the manufacture, repair, refurbishment, and upliftment of transformers in India. The company offers power transformers, such as systems, generator, auto, and furnace transformers, as well as rectifiers and railway duty products, etc.; and single and 3 phase, extra high voltage, and special purpose transformers.
